Responsibilities
  • Assist with enforcing and adhering to company, Environmental Health & Safety (EH&S), and risk management policies and procedures on construction projects.
  • Support identification, elimination, and control of hazardous conditions to prevent injuries and property damage.
  • Assist with providing training for safe work practices and implementing Building L.I.F.E. (Living Injury Free Every Day) and EH&S programs, policies, and procedures for project and trade employees.
  • Assist with reviewing subcontractor safety programs for completeness and compliance with company policies, regulations, and owner contract requirements.
  • Assist with reviewing subcontractor training per OSHA standards and promoting safe work practices and conditions in accordance with regulations and contractual requirements.
  • Assist with administration of the drug screening program (pre-employment, post-accident, random, etc.) in alignment with company and project owner requirements.
  • Assist with coordination of preconstruction meetings and conduct effective worker orientation programs, including administration and participation records.
  • Assist with gathering Pre-Task Plans (PTPs) and Job Hazard Analyses (JHAs) for project contractors based on contractual requirements.
  • Assist with maintaining safety records (PTPs, JHAs, training records, toolbox talks, OSHA 300 log, MSDS, chemical inventory sheets, incident investigations and metrics).
  • Assist with conducting safety meetings, recording and issuing meeting minutes, and maintaining logs of toolbox safety meetings for subcontractors.
  • Assist with safety audits and work area inspections, developing inspection summaries with corrective actions, and reporting violations to subcontractors for immediate resolution.
  • Assist with identifying and reporting safety violations or unsafe practices, with emphasis on imminent danger situations.
  • Other activities, duties, and responsibilities as assigned.
